Musk’s comment touches on a broader issue about the power and importance of branding in politics. The “Make America Great Again” (MAGA) hats, popularized by former President Donald Trump, became iconic symbols of his campaign and presidency. They were visible at rallies, protests, and in everyday life, making them a powerful tool for rallying support and creating a sense of identity among his followers.

In contrast, the “Build Back Better” slogan, while central to Biden’s policy agenda, has not achieved the same level of visibility or cultural penetration. This disparity raises questions about the effectiveness of political branding and the role it plays in shaping public perception and engagement.
